Irrigation is one of the most energy-intensive tasks on a farm. Traditional diesel-powered pumps are costly to maintain and harmful to the environment.
Why solar-powered water pumps matter:
Ideal for drip and sprinkler irrigation systems
Run on DC or AC solar power, with inverter options for grid/hybrid systems
Low maintenance, especially with brushless motors
Can be integrated with smart controllers for scheduled watering
Best for: Vegetable farmers, dry-season irrigation, remote farms without grid access
Solar inverters convert the DC power from solar panels into usable AC power for tools, equipment, and appliances.
Types to consider:
Off-grid solar inverters: For farms without reliable grid access
Hybrid solar inverters: Combine solar, battery, and grid power
Pure sine wave inverters: For sensitive equipment like incubators and milk chillers
Why it’s essential:
Powers farmhouses, cold storage, poultry operations, and processing equipment
Supports battery backup for night or cloudy-day operations
Ensures energy efficiency and reliability
Tip: Choose inverters that allow MPPT solar charge controllers for better performance and energy savings.
Post-harvest loss is a major issue for small farmers. Solar-powered cold storage systems help preserve crops, dairy, and meat products.
Features to look for:
The temperature range is between 0°C and 10°C
Battery-supported or thermal energy storage
Integrated with solar + inverter backup
Optional remote monitoring for commercial farmers
Best for: Perishable crop farmers, livestock, and dairy operators
Security is critical in open-field farming. Solar-powered electric fencing offers a sustainable, low-maintenance solution.
Why farmers love it:
Keeps livestock safe and deters intruders
Works even during power outages
Inverter is not always required, direct DC systems are available
Scalable for both small and large farms
Temperature and humidity control are key to storing crops and managing greenhouses.
Benefits of solar-powered ventilation:
Maintains airflow without relying on grid power
Protects stored grains from mold and pests
Reduces spoilage in greenhouse environments
Cost-effective and easy to install
